Summary:
Rose has run away from an arranged marriage in her home island. Her sister in town, Rebecca, is sheltering her and nobody knows where she is. Rebecca's husband John is involved in the election campaign in his area on behalf of their local candidates. But then Rose's father calls from the island and asks the chief to find Rose. Suddenly everyone is out looking for her!
